summaryrefslogtreecommitdiff
path: root/index.php
diff options
context:
space:
mode:
Diffstat (limited to 'index.php')
-rw-r--r--index.php6
1 files changed, 4 insertions, 2 deletions
diff --git a/index.php b/index.php
index fa6e7af0e8..264cc8537f 100644
--- a/index.php
+++ b/index.php
@@ -26,9 +26,9 @@ use Fisharebest\Webtrees\Http\Middleware\CheckCsrf;
use Fisharebest\Webtrees\Http\Middleware\CheckForMaintenanceMode;
use Fisharebest\Webtrees\Http\Middleware\DebugBarData;
use Fisharebest\Webtrees\Http\Middleware\Housekeeping;
-use Fisharebest\Webtrees\Http\Middleware\PageHitCounter;
use Fisharebest\Webtrees\Http\Middleware\UseTransaction;
use Fisharebest\Webtrees\I18N;
+use Fisharebest\Webtrees\Module;
use Fisharebest\Webtrees\Services\TimeoutService;
use Fisharebest\Webtrees\Session;
use Fisharebest\Webtrees\Site;
@@ -267,7 +267,6 @@ try {
}
if ($request->getMethod() === Request::METHOD_GET) {
- $middleware_stack[] = PageHitCounter::class;
$middleware_stack[] = Housekeeping::class;
}
@@ -276,6 +275,9 @@ try {
$middleware_stack[] = CheckCsrf::class;
}
+ // Boot the modules.
+ Module::boot();
+
// Apply the middleware using the "onion" pattern.
$pipeline = array_reduce($middleware_stack, function (Closure $next, string $middleware): Closure {
// Create a closure to apply the middleware.